A genre-bending RPG inspired by the classic Paper Mario games! Ever After Inc, a greedy megacorp from the real world, is taking over fairytales for their cheap labor and it’s up to you to fight back! Experience Escape from Ever After’s first chapter in this prologue version of the full game.

Pros
- Faithful and fresh paper mario-inspired gameplay
- Engaging turn-based combat with timing mechanics
- Charming story and characters with humor
- Colorful art style and jazzy soundtrack
- Plentiful secrets and exploration
Cons
- Strict timing windows can frustrate some players
- Some balancing issues in combat difficulty
- Minor bugs and control sluggishness reported
- Level-up point distribution can feel limiting
- Platforming depth perception challenges
